Quarterly Planning Note — Support Outsourcing. Hi sales leads — quick heads-up: from next quarter, tier-one support moves to Bellwick Assist, our new partner in Norbay. Your accounts keep their named contacts; only first-line tickets change hands. Expect a few bumps in week one, so warn key customers gently. The reasoning behind this move is outlined just below.

management briefing: Goroxix Systems is in early talks to buy Kelethek Holdings for about $118.0 million. The Sileth launch date is February 25, and nothing goes to the press before then. Legal wants the Pelokox Logistics term sheet withdrawn before December 14.

### Changed Defaults — LiftLogic Simulator 4.2

Plugin authors, please note: the default dispatch strategy has changed from `nearest-car` to `zoned-peak`, and the idle-parking floor is no longer the lobby. Plugins that read dispatch state without declaring a strategy dependency may observe different car assignments during morning-rush scenarios. For reference, the simulator now ships with the following default configuration values.

service settings:
[casax]
port = 6379
team = rusir
host = casax.zemvarhq.corp
region = outer-4
access_code = ac_9808ce
timeout_ms = 1500

Team, as promised, a recap of Tuesday's cut-over of the StallCount occupancy feed from the legacy poller to the new event-driven pipeline. Drain started at 02:00, the Kervale and Ostbridge garages switched first, and full traffic moved by 03:40 with no dropped sensor frames. One rollback trigger fired (stale-read alarm) but self-cleared within two minutes. Remaining follow-ups: retire the poller VMs and update the on-call runbook. For the record, the new pipeline went live with the following configuration.

config for kafof-bawef:
holath:
  log_level: debug
  metrics_host: metrics.holath.qorvelsys.internal
  pin: 2191
  pool_size: 32